Re: IHOP (International House of Prayer)
IHOP'S strength is in its end time doctrine. They are the only major (in size) Church teaching the post tribulation rapture. They also teach a good discipleship message and even have a better understanding than most on Perfection and Holiness.
It is a young Church mostly people in their 20's and 30's. Misty Edwards attends there as a worship leader. She is the best Christian Musician of my lifetime. There are other good worship teams there also. The praise and worship no doubt draws many to them.
Look at the end of the article and you will see they have many outreach ministries.
On the negative side they are true Trinitarians.
